rangelib.py: Fix the bug in monotonic check.

RangeSet("2-10").monotonic gives a wrong result of "False". Fix the bug
and add more tests into test_rangelib.py.

Change-Id: I04780571b45ecafd34040f405756b9745a9e21a5
